56 WHEREAS, Kenneth M. Jastrow II and Susan Thomas Jastrow have
67 been recognized with the Santa Rita Award for their exceptional
78 commitment to The University of Texas at Austin; and
89 WHEREAS, Established in 1968, the Santa Rita Award is the
910 highest honor bestowed by the UT System Board of Regents; the award
1011 is given to individuals or organizations whose philanthropy and
1112 service have greatly furthered the mission of UT institutions and
1213 the cause of higher education; and
1314 WHEREAS, Kenny Jastrow is the former chair and CEO of
1415 Temple-Inland, Inc.; he has served his alma mater, UT Austin,
1516 through leadership roles on a number of boards, commissions, and
1617 committees, including as chair of the historic Commission of 125,
1718 which was created to commemorate the campus's 125th anniversary,
1819 and as chair of the $3 billion Campaign for Texas in 2013; he
1920 recently led the Special Advisory Committee for UT Austin's
2021 presidential search that resulted in the appointment of President
2122 Jay Hartzell; and
2223 WHEREAS, Over the years, Mr. Jastrow has been presented with
2324 such accolades as the Distinguished Alumnus Award, the Presidential
2425 Citation, the Mirabeau B. Lamar Medal, and the Legion of Honor Award
2526 by Phi Delta Theta, in addition to being inducted into the McCombs
2627 School of Business's Hall of Fame; and
2728 WHEREAS, Susie Jastrow, a registered dietitian and diabetes
2829 educator, is the founder of the Nutrition Education Program within
2930 People's Community Clinic, a health care provider for uninsured and
3031 medically underserved residents of Austin; she was also
3132 instrumental in the establishment of the UT Austin Nutrition
3233 Institute, and she has given generously of her time to the Blanton
3334 Museum of Art National Leadership Board, the Natural Sciences
3435 Foundation Advisory Council, and the Human Ecology School Advisory
3536 Council; and
3637 WHEREAS, Recognized as Alumna of the Year by the Texas Exes in
3738 2006, Ms. Jastrow was also honored with its Community Service Award
3839 in Human Ecology, and in 2017, the Susie Jastrow Teaching Kitchen
3940 was dedicated on the campus at UT Austin; together with
4041 Mr. Jastrow, she takes special pride in having launched Subiendo:
4142 The Academy for Rising Leaders, a youth leadership program that is
4243 hosted by the McCombs School; and
4344 WHEREAS, Through their tremendous generosity and support for
4445 The University of Texas at Austin, Kenneth and Susan Jastrow have
4546 elevated its reputation as a world-class center of higher learning,
4647 and they are indeed deserving recipients of the UT System's most
4748 prestigious award; now, therefore, be it
4849 RESOLVED, That the 87th Legislature of the State of Texas,
4950 3rd Called Session, hereby congratulate Kenneth and Susan Jastrow
5051 on their receipt of the Santa Rita Award by The University of Texas
5152 System Board of Regents and extend to them sincere appreciation for
5253 their far-reaching contributions; and, be it further
5354 RESOLVED, That an official copy of this resolution be
5455 prepared for the Jastrows as an expression of high regard by the
5556 Texas House of Representatives and Senate.
